Biography

Jonathan Demme was a prolific American filmmaker, producer, and screenwriter whose career spanned over three decades. Demme directed a number of critically acclaimed films, including Silence of the Lambs (1991), which won Best Picture, Best Director, Best Screenplay, Best Actor, and Best Actress at the Academy Awards. His concert film Stop Making Sense (1984), now widely regarded as one of the greatest of all time, was added to the Library of Congress’s National Film Registry in 2021.
